Understanding the Different Types of Digestive Enzymes
Digestive enzymes are specialized proteins that play a vital role in breaking down food into smaller, absorbable molecules. Your body produces them in the salivary glands, stomach, pancreas, and small intestine. Different enzymes target specific types of food molecules, namely carbohydrates, proteins, and fats.
Major Classes of Digestive Enzymes
- Proteases: These enzymes break down proteins into smaller peptides and amino acids. They are produced in the stomach and pancreas and are essential for digesting protein-rich foods like meat, eggs, and legumes. Common proteases include pepsin, trypsin, and chymotrypsin.
- Amylases: Responsible for breaking down complex carbohydrates and starches into simple sugars like glucose. Amylase is found in saliva and is also produced by the pancreas.
- Lipases: This group of enzymes breaks down fats (lipids) into fatty acids and glycerol. The pancreas is the primary source of lipase, which acts in the small intestine, and deficiencies can lead to difficulty digesting high-fat meals.
- Lactase: A specialized enzyme that breaks down lactose, the sugar found in dairy products, into glucose and galactose. A shortage of lactase causes lactose intolerance, leading to uncomfortable symptoms after consuming dairy.
- Cellulase and Alpha-Galactosidase: These are particularly important for digesting plant-based foods. Cellulase breaks down fiber from fruits and vegetables, while alpha-galactosidase helps digest the complex sugars found in beans and legumes that can cause gas and bloating.
Natural vs. Supplemental Digestive Enzymes
While a healthy body produces all the enzymes it needs, certain conditions and lifestyle factors can hinder production. This is where supplements can help. Natural enzymes can also be found in foods like pineapple (bromelain), papaya (papain), and fermented items, but their direct impact can be limited. Supplemental enzymes offer a more targeted and potent solution for specific deficiencies.
How to Choose the Right Digestive Enzyme Supplement
Selecting a supplement requires careful consideration of your individual symptoms and dietary habits. A broad-spectrum blend containing proteases, amylases, and lipases is a good starting point for general digestive support. For more specific issues, you may need a targeted formula.
- Identify Your Specific Needs: Track your symptoms and note which foods trigger them. For example, if dairy causes bloating, a supplement with high lactase content is ideal. If protein-heavy meals feel heavy, prioritize a blend with high protease activity.
- Look for Third-Party Testing: Since the FDA does not regulate all supplements, choose products verified for safety and quality by organizations like NSF, USP, or ConsumerLab.
- Consider Potency: Enzymes are measured in activity units (e.g., HUT for protease, DU for amylase) rather than milligrams. Higher unit values generally indicate stronger action, but it's important to start with a lower dose.
- Check for Added Ingredients: Opt for clean, natural formulas free of unnecessary fillers, binders, or artificial additives. Some high-quality brands include supporting ingredients like ginger or peppermint leaf for additional digestive relief.
- Choose Plant-Based if Possible: Plant-based and fungal enzymes are generally preferred over animal-based versions because they work effectively across a wider pH range, making them more resilient to stomach acid.
Comparison Table of Digestive Enzyme Types
| Enzyme Type | Primary Function | Foods Digested | Best For... |
|---|---|---|---|
| Amylase | Breaks down carbohydrates and starches | Breads, pasta, rice, potatoes | Bloating from starchy meals |
| Protease | Breaks down proteins | Meats, eggs, dairy, legumes | Sluggishness after high-protein meals |
| Lipase | Breaks down fats | Fatty foods, oils, dairy | Difficulty digesting high-fat foods or gallbladder issues |
| Lactase | Breaks down lactose (milk sugar) | Dairy products (milk, cheese) | Lactose intolerance symptoms |
| Cellulase | Breaks down fiber | Fruits, vegetables, grains | Gas and bloating from high-fiber foods |
| Alpha-Galactosidase | Breaks down complex sugars in legumes | Beans, nuts, lentils | Reducing gas and bloating from legumes |
| Bromelain | Breaks down proteins | Pineapple | Mild protein digestion support |
How Digestive Enzymes Work to Improve Health
When a deficiency occurs, large food particles can move through the digestive tract undigested. This can lead to fermentation by gut bacteria, causing gas and bloating. By supplementing with the right enzymes, you ensure more complete digestion and nutrient absorption. Conditions like Exocrine Pancreatic Insufficiency (EPI), lactose intolerance, and irritable bowel syndrome (IBS) are often linked to enzyme shortages. In EPI, the pancreas fails to produce enough enzymes, while lactose intolerance is a deficiency of lactase. Some research even suggests that alpha-galactosidase may help alleviate IBS symptoms in sensitive individuals. Furthermore, poor nutrient absorption due to enzyme insufficiency can manifest as fatigue, weight loss, or skin issues, as the body isn't getting the building blocks it needs. A high-quality, comprehensive formula can address these wide-ranging symptoms by ensuring your body efficiently processes the food you eat.

Supporting Natural Enzyme Production
In addition to supplements, supporting your body's natural enzyme production through diet can be beneficial.
- Eat Raw Foods: Incorporating more raw fruits and vegetables, especially pineapple, papaya, mango, and avocado, can boost natural enzyme intake.
- Chew Thoroughly: Digestion begins in the mouth, and chewing food properly gives salivary amylase more time to begin breaking down carbs.
- Stay Hydrated: Water is essential for all digestive functions.
- Limit Processed Foods: Highly processed and fatty foods are harder to digest and can place extra strain on your digestive system.
- Consider Fermented Foods: Sauerkraut, kefir, and kimchi contain beneficial enzymes and probiotics that aid gut health.
Ultimately, a combination of mindful eating and targeted supplementation, when necessary, is the most effective strategy for optimizing digestive health.
